
Prime Video's Season 2 Reversal: The Peripheral and A League of Their Own Cancelled
Prime Video has canceled the sci-fi series The Peripheral after initially announcing its renewal for a second season. The decision was made due to ongoing strikes involving the Writers Guild of America (WGA) and the Screen Actors Guild-American Federation of Television and Radio Artists (SAG-AFTRA). The show's production delays and the studios' failure to agree on desired terms with the unions led to the cancellation. This is not the first time a streaming platform or network has canceled a show after initially offering additional seasons. The cancellations highlight the studios' reluctance to meet the demands of actors and writers who are advocating for better wages and working conditions.
